Marion city, Texas Citizen Voting-age Population By Race and Ethnicity in 2024 (ACS-5Yrs)
Based on the US Census Bureau's special tabulation from the ACS 5-year estimates, in 2024, the citizen voting-age population for Marion city, Texas was 667. The Non-Hispanic White Alone ethnicity group had the highest citizen voting-age population (296) and constituted 44.38% of the total.
The Hispanic or Latino of All Races ethnicity group had the second highest citizen voting-age population (263) and constituted 39.43% of the total. The Non-Hispanic Two Or More Races ethnicity group had the third highest (39), constituting 5.85% of the total citizen voting-age population.

| Ethnicity | Voting-age Population | % of Voting-age Pop. |
|---|---|---|
| Non-Hispanic White Alone | 296 | 44.38 |
| Hispanic or Latino of All Races | 263 | 39.43 |
| Non-Hispanic Two Or More Races | 39 | 5.85 |
| Non-Hispanic Black or African American Alone | 36 | 5.40 |
| Non-Hispanic Asian Alone | 30 | 4.50 |
| Non-Hispanic Native Hawaiian And Pacific Islander Alone | 1 | 0.15 |
